Lucene search

K
securityvulnsSecurityvulnsSECURITYVULNS:DOC:8767
HistoryJun 01, 2005 - 12:00 a.m.

[SA15543] PHPMailer "Data()" Denial of Service Vulnerability

2005-06-0100:00:00
vulners.com
11

Bist Du interessiert an einem neuen Job in IT-Sicherheit?

Secunia hat zwei freie Stellen als Junior und Senior Spezialist in IT-
Sicherheit:
http://secunia.com/secunia_vacancies/


TITLE:
PHPMailer "Data()" Denial of Service Vulnerability

SECUNIA ADVISORY ID:
SA15543

VERIFY ADVISORY:
http://secunia.com/advisories/15543/

CRITICAL:
Less critical

IMPACT:
DoS

WHERE:
>From remote

SOFTWARE:
PHPMailer 1.x
http://secunia.com/product/5177/

DESCRIPTION:
Mariano Nuсez Di Croce has reported a vulnerability in PHPMailer,
which can be exploited by malicious people to cause a DoS (Denial of
Service).

The vulnerability is caused due to an error in the processing of
overly long headers in the "Data()" function in "class.smtp.php".
This can be exploited to consume a large amount of CPU and memory
resources on a vulnerable server via an application using the
vulnerable mail library.

The vulnerability has been reported in version 1.7.2. Other versions
may also be affected.

SOLUTION:
Edit the source code to ensure that input is properly verified.

PROVIDED AND/OR DISCOVERED BY:
Mariano Nuсez Di Croce, CYBSEC S.A.

ORIGINAL ADVISORY:
http://www.cybsec.com/vuln/PHPMailer-DOS.pdf


About:
This Advisory was delivered by Secunia as a free service to help
everybody keeping their systems up to date against the latest
vulnerabilities.

Subscribe:
http://secunia.com/secunia_security_advisories/

Definitions: (Criticality, Where etc.)
http://secunia.com/about_secunia_advisories/

Please Note:
Secunia recommends that you verify all advisories you receive by
clicking the link.
Secunia NEVER sends attached files with advisories.
Secunia does not advise people to install third party patches, only
use those supplied by the vendor.